The weber daughter Sophie Sabina Apitzsch (* 1692 in Lunzenau; "† 3 February 1752 in Lunzenau) was a Hochstaplerin in early 18. Century. Today it is well-known as a "prince Lieschen".

In the year 1710 she got engaged with a hunter in the service of the lock smelling castle.
